What companies run services between Bridport, England and Freshwater, England?
There is no direct connection from Bridport to Freshwater. However, you can take the bus to King Statue K8 Approach, walk to Weymouth, take the train to Brockenhurst, take the train to Lymington Pier, walk to Lymington Pier Ferry Terminal, take the ferry to Yarmouth IOW Ferry Terminal, walk to Bus Station, then take the bus to Sainsburys.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Town Centre to School Green Road via South Station, Bournemouth Station, Bournemouth, Brockenhurst, Lymington Pier, Lymington Pier Ferry Terminal, Yarmouth IOW Ferry Terminal, and Bus Station in around 5h 21m.
